Start with length and perimeter
Identify where the cut ends and whether the lower edge looks blunt, rounded, graduated, or broken up. Those decisions remain visible even when the hair is styled differently.
Compare layers with your natural texture
Layers behave differently on straight, wavy, curly, fine, and dense hair. Focus on where they begin and how much weight remains at the ends.
Build a clearer salon reference
Combine a front image with a side or back view when possible. Name the exact details you want preserved instead of asking for the entire photograph to be copied.
